Сколько записей я могу вставить, используя DynamoDb BatchWrite от Boto3 - PullRequest
0 голосов
/ 23 ноября 2018

Используя пакетную вставку Boto3, максимальное количество записей мы можем вставить в таблицу Dynamodb.Предположим, я читаю мой входной JSON из корзины S3 размером 6 ГБ.

И это вызывает проблемы с производительностью при вставке в пакетном режиме.Любой образец полезен.Я только начал изучать это, основываясь на своих выводах, которые я обновлю здесь.

Заранее спасибо.

1 Ответ

0 голосов
/ 23 ноября 2018

Подобную информацию можно найти в документации по сервису для BatchWriteItem :

Один вызов BatchWriteItem может записать до 16 МБ данных, которые могут содержать столько жекак 25 ставить или удалять запросы.Размер отдельных записываемых элементов может достигать 400 КБ.

Нет проблем с производительностью, кроме потребления единиц записи.

...